Headquartered at Joint Base Langley-Eustis, Virginia, the 480 ISRW is the Air Force leader in globally networked ISR operations and operates the Air Force Distributed Common Ground System (AF DCGS). It’s part of a complex, integrated, and collaborative system of systems designed to task, collect, process, exploit/analyze, and disseminate intelligence information collected from airborne ISR collection platforms and sensors.
